Output 51ce7d06c20e00473fe734c3fab898923326253e03da0b5d05c167217dc6b563:0

value
1560000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86ae415c533eddb2f74ede9b197092d6a4e42089 OP_EQUALVERIFY OP_CHECKSIG
address
1DH8JBFq7QeJbrEr1T3vMWEU2yXPuk4e4k
transaction
51ce7d06c20e00473fe734c3fab898923326253e03da0b5d05c167217dc6b563
spent
true